A great close-quarters combat knife, this fixed blade from TOPS Knives is ready for almost anything you can put it through. Made with durable 1095 high carbon steel, this knife was made to cut through just about anything. The jagged teeth on the topside help to grab whatever you are penetrating and rip it to shreds. It also works as a notcher or saw. Swinging this knife allows it to chop wood superbly. This knife was designed as a survival tool and can chop, split, scrape, hammer saw, and more. It was designed by noted survivalist Tom Brown Jr.

Specifications

  • Blade Length: 5.00"
  • Cutting Edge: 4.88"
  • Secondary Edge: 2.00"
  • Handle Length: 4.50"
  • Overall Length: 9.50"
  • Blade Thickness: 0.190"
  • Blade Material: 1095 Carbon Steel
  • Blade Hardness: 56-58HRC
  • Blade Finish: Black Traction Coating
  • Handle Material: Black Linen Micarta
  • Sheath: Black Kydex
  • Sheath Clip: Multi-Position Spring Steel
  • Weight: 9.6 oz.
  • Weight with Sheath: 14.0 oz.
  • Designer: Tom Brown Jr.
  • Made in the USA

Wonderful Tool
This is a great outdoor tool. It seems to be a blend of a hatchet, draw knife, bush knife, and wire cutter. Yes, you could use a hatchet and a good field knife to get the job done. However, it is highly unusual looking and looks cool for whatever that is worth. I would get aknife maker to change the blade angle on the draw blade and the front especially to make it more useful for other jobs. I'm not too sure about the wire cutter feature because I do not really need this for woodcraft or bushcraft but it can make notches in the wood. I did not think it worked well as a substitute saw (IMO). I still give it 2 thumbs up for a great outdoor tool. I do have the 6.38 #1 Tracker but it is just to big and heavy to carry around in the woods for hiking/camping/fishing/hunting all day.
